How guest reviews work
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.
You can review an Accommodation that you booked through our Platform if you stayed there or if you arrived at the property but didn’t actually stay there. To edit a review you’ve already submitted, please contact our Customer Service team.
We have people and automated systems that specialise in detecting fake reviews submitted to our Platform. If we find any, we delete them and, if necessary, take action against whoever is responsible.
Anyone else who spots something suspicious can always report it to our Customer Service team, so our Fraud team can investigate.

Verified reviewThe room was clean and the host was very friendly and helpful, providing transport when we needed it. Air-conditioning was good when there wasn't a blackout. Local shop was convenient.
The room was smaller than we would have liked and the location was more remote from Nadi than we expected. (The address provided, Nadi Back Road, was inaccurate; house was on Nawaka Road, over 1.5 km from Nadi Back Rd.) There was no TV and no streaming service as stated in listing, but there was good wi-fi (host blamed Booking.com for delay in updating.)

Verified reviewThe location is just outside of Nadi town. Hamen also has a car available for rent at a great rate. I took the taxi and bus while I was staying there. For those who prefer to drive on their own, I would recommend talking to Hamen about his car rental. The room has A/C, a private bathroom, a mini fridge, and a microwave. I was very comfortable during my stay. The host is kind and attentive. I would book with him again.
